About the role
The Infusion Scheduling Coordinator is responsible for planning and coordinating chemo/infusion treatments to ensure patients are scheduled accurately and efficiently. This role is vital in improving patient access by balancing patient load and optimizing resource utilization.
Responsibilities
- Schedule chemo/infusion treatments following established protocols.
- Complete infusion scheduling requests and communicate updates to patients.
- Use scheduling software to enhance infusion resource utilization and patient flow.
- Collaborate with Infusion Team, Physician Nurses, and Medical Assistants to coordinate schedule changes.
- Verify schedule accuracy; manage chemo scrubbing reports.
- Train and orient new employees as assigned.
- Cookordinate pharmacy orders with physicians/nurses.
- Manage phone and email communication related to scheduling.
- Maintain scheduling calendars and reschedule appointments promptly.
- Collaborate with internal departments (Phone Room, Medical Records, Insurance, Front Desk, Pharmacy) for record verification.
- Man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ced setting.
- Participate in staff meetings and team-based operations.
